    Ep 32 HBO's Love Life, Season 2

    Play Episode Listen Later Nov 30, 2021 30:34


    This week, the Screentimers review Season 2 of the HBO Series Love Life. The series follows a single millennial as they navigate various relationships (dating, marriage, friendship, and otherwise) while living in New York City. While Season 1 followed Darby, played by Anna Kendrick (Pitch Perfect), Season 2 follows a brand new character named Marcus, played by William Jackson Harper (The Good Place), a newly divorced book editor new to the dating scene. This season is hilarious, deep, and will give you all the feels! Topics discussed in this review include: Is Season 2 a romantic comedy or a drama with comedic elements? What does representation really mean and how does Season 2 nail it? How should film and TV incorporate the COVID-19 pandemic into their stories? And more! Plus, you do not need to watch Season 1 to appreciate Season 2, so jump on in and let us know what you think!     Ep 22: Candyman

    Play Episode Listen Later Sep 13, 2021 31:52


    This week, Alex, Shantae, Dave, and Anselm discuss the most recent update to the infamous urban legend Candyman (2021). Written and directed by Nia DaCosta and co-written and produced by Jordan Peele, Candyman, like its 1992 predecessor, is the latest film to use the horror genre to explore the impact of racism on the Black experience in America. The team discusses everything from how Candyman delivers on the horror thrills, to how it depicts violence against Black people, and even whether Candyman is a super hero origin story.     Ep 15: Black Mirror Season 3 Appreciation Episode

    Play Episode Listen Later Jul 26, 2021 45:46


    In this episode, originally recorded in Spring 2020, the Screentimers looks back at Season 3 of the dystopian anthology series Black Mirror's, which they argue is its best. Through topics like social media as capitalism, the new frontiers of blackmail, virtual reality, and more, David, Alex, Shantae, and Anselm dig into the ways that this series, while being set in the the near future, is much more a reflection of where we are now than where we are headed and how technology is steering us in that direction.     Ep 9: Judas and the Black Messiah

    Play Episode Listen Later Jun 21, 2021 49:33


    Dave, Anselm, Alex, and Shantae review best picture nominee Judas and the Black Messiah. The true story stars LaKeith Stanfield as Bill O'Neal, instructed by the FBI to infiltrate the Chicago chapter of the Black Panther Party and gather intel on Chairman Fred Hampton (Daniel Kaluuya) that would eventually lead to his assassination. The team covers a variety of topics including: The Academy's unusual decision to place both actors in the 'Supporting Role' category. Their vision for a Judas and the Black Messiah TV series.     Ep 4: The Trial of the Chicago 7

    Play Episode Listen Later Jun 7, 2021 45:27


    Dave, Anselm, Shantae, and Alex review Netflix's best picture nominee The Trial of the Chicago 7. From writer-director Aaron Sorkin, the legal drama is based on the infamous trial of 7 anti-Vietnam War protestors charged by the federal government with conspiracy and inciting riots at the 1968 Democratic National Convention. The team debates the resurgence of the courtroom thriller, breaks down Sorkin's political idealism, and discusses the film's handling of race.
